OIC vows to reduce unemployment in member countries

JEDDAH-SABA
The ministers of labor at the Organization of Islamic Conference (OIC) have confirmed that they are working to reduce unemployment rates in member countries whose unemployment rate averaged 7.4 per cent in 2016, above the global average.
The ministers stressed during their declaration issued at the end of their conference concluded in Jeddah, Saudi Arabia, on Thursday that the issue of employment is essential for the well-being of people and economic growth.
The Ministers announced the expansion of coordination and cooperation among OIC members with regard to labor, employment and social protection for labor.
Yemen's participating delegation in the event was represented by Minister of Social Affairs and Labor Ibtihaj al-Kamal.
